Builders worked tirelessly to design newer and fancier ways to add decor and ornamentation to houses of this era. Travel to japan and india influenced exotic design elements in the home. The overall theme of victorian homes is superfluous and ornate with a desire for decoration; When you picture a victorian house, you might envision a colorful dollhouse, or maybe an imposing haunted house comes to mind. A victorian house is easily identified by its intricate gables, hipped roofline, bay windows, and use of hexagonal or octagonal.
